   As three Campus Infrastructure Development (CID) roadway projects near completion, “Out with the old, in with the new” will be a noticeable view when the Niner community returns to campus in January.
   During the holiday break work on the intersection of Mary Alexander Road and Cameron Boulevard, and the remainder of Mary Alexander Road and Craver Road projects will be completed.  Structural changes in each area will include fully operational signal lights, bike lanes, and sidewalks.  Minor work activities will continue on sidewalks and bus shelters.
   The Phillips Road realignment will be close to completion, but vehicles and pedestrians will continue to use the existing Phillips road until the new bridge is completed in February.
